Historical & Cultural Background

The name Lilian has its roots in the Latin word "lilium," which means "lily." The lily flower has been a symbol of purity and beauty throughout various cultures, often associated with the Virgin Mary in Christian iconography. The name evolved through several linguistic stages, transitioning from Latin to Old French as "Lilian" or "Lilliane," before being adopted into English. The earliest recorded use of the name in English dates back to the 19th century, although its floral connotation has been present in various forms for centuries prior.

Historically, the name Lilian has been linked to notable figures, including saints and literary characters. One significant milestone is its association with Saint Lilian, a Christian martyr from the early centuries of the Church, whose legacy contributed to the name's adoption in Christian communities. The name gained further prominence through literary works in the 19th century, particularly in Victorian literature, where floral names were popularized as symbols of femininity and virtue. The name's association with the lily flower also ties it to various cultural traditions, including its use in weddings and other ceremonies as a symbol of purity and renewal.

Culturally, Lilian resonates with themes of innocence and grace, often evoking imagery of gardens and nature. The name has been embraced in various forms, including diminutives like Lily, which further emphasize its floral roots. The enduring appeal of Lilian can be attributed to its aesthetic qualities and the positive associations tied to the lily flower, making it a name that has maintained its significance across different eras and cultures.

U.S. Historical Usage

The name Lilian was first seen in the United States in 1880. Lilian has ranked as high as #708 nationally, which occurred in 2007, and has been most popular in California, Texas, New York, Illinois, and Florida. In the past 5 years the name Lilian has been trending down compared to the previous 5 years.
